Frequently Asked Questions

How is Trauma Recovery Coaching different from other types of coaching?
Trauma Recovery Coaching is different than other types of coaching because we do look at the past traumas, and how they have affected clients in the present day. Other types of coaching look only at the present/future with clients, and don’t dig down to find the root of how a client’s experience has been colored by developmental trauma. We do not use structured theories, diagnose/assess mental illness or tell clients what they should do in a given situation. We do discuss options, look at areas of potential growth, set recovery goals and view experiences, positive or negative as learning opportunities, guiding the client to see the best potential outcome for them. There is a distinct equality to the relationship, we support the client no matter what they choose to do, always validating, and understanding how they got here. The client is responsible for the outcome and growth. Trauma Recovery Coaches work in the aftereffects of trauma: codependency, shame, addiction, self-harm, focus on self-care and self-compassion, with tools to manage daily life as a survivor who is healing. 

(Responses provided by Jennifer Kindera and Linda Meredith)

What is it like to work with a Trauma Recovery Coach?
Trauma Recovery Coaching offers an honest and compassionate space for the unfolding of your healing journey. The goal is to help the client address the issues that hinder them from living more fully, deeply and with greater satisfaction. We explore at the client’s pace, the broken core beliefs that trauma/abuse teaches us, and how those are affecting you today. Setting small recovery goals, and succeeding in reaching them, looking at your strengths, celebrating the small victories as well as the big wins, reframing negative narratives to learning opportunities. Clients often comment that Trauma Recovery Coaching was the first relationship they felt they could actually believe in. Teaching clients healthy coping skills and tools to stabilize their lives in the short term. We work collaboratively and foster a safe space. Integrating psychoeducation, the neuroscience of trauma, somatic recognition and trigger tools, together we can manage the symptoms of complex trauma, increase awareness and create experiences for growth and healing.

 

(Responses provided by Jennifer Kindera and Linda Meredith)

I don’t feel comfortable talking to a stranger about my trauma experiences. Do I have to tell you everything about my past?
Only if you choose to. It is not necessary for the details of any situation to be shared. The great thing about trauma recovery coaching is that the techniques and skills are aimed at correcting issues affecting you in the present not the past. Coaching aims to build upon the strengths and knowledge that you already have and looks at finding solutions to problems rather than focusing on the causes. The entire coaching process is client-led.
